Prince William Sound Kayak Fishing


Whittier Water Taxi is now renting Wilderness Systems Pungo 140 fishing kayaks.  We have been testing a pair of these very stable kayaks since this spring and our customers who have rented these kayaks have given us very positive reviews. Not only are they very stable and track nicely, they have a roomy cockpit with very comfortable seats. The Pungo 140s are lighter than most kayaks and are easy to handle in and out of the water, making your kayaking adventure more enjoyable! The increased weight capacity, storage hatches for gear and increased tracking let you go the distance in the comfort of a sit-inside kayak. Many who own these kayaks have found out how versatile these boats are and have written very good reviews about them.  Fishing from a kayak can be very challenging with a standard single kayak - a nice sized silver salmon can roll you into the water or wrap your line around the rudder and deck rigging. Not so with these kayaks - they are designed to be stable enough to fight your catch and have no snags to break your line. Our Pungo 140s have two rod holders: one behind you for while you’re paddling to your destination and one on the front deck. (No fumbling with your fishing rod while trying to maneuver around!) Wilderness Systems also installed holders for your paddle while you’re fishing and there is a removable consol for your tackle with a beverage holder. These 14 foot kayaks can carry close to the same amount of gear as a typical 17 foot single. This is perfect for those who want to explore the more remote parts of Prince William Sound and catch dinner on the same trip!
